Amrit Bansalwas born on October 6, 1950 at Jaitu, District Faridkot, Punjab, India. He passed his matriculation from Govt. H. S. National High School, Jaitu in March, 1966 with flying colors and obtained his B.A (Hon’s) in English from Govt. Brijendra College, Faridkot in April, 1971. He obtained his degree in law from Kurukshetra University, Kurukshetra in April, 1974 and practised law at District Courts, Faridkot from 1974 to 1978. He was appointed as Executive Officer in the Municipal Administration of Punjab in 1978 and has served as such at the stations of Mohali, Zirakpur, Derabassi, Kharar, Kurali, Morinda, Goniana, Nangal, Gurdaspur, Abohar, Pathankot, Ropar, Anandpur Sahib and in U.T. Administration, Chandigarh with distinction. He was instrumental in the development of the new towns of S.A.S. Nagar (Mohali), Zirakpur, Kharar and Anandpur Sahib. Thereafter he went on a business leave for three years and successfully started a real estate company in 2004 at Mohali. He is currently practising as a lawyer in the Punjab and Haryana High Court at Chandigarh since March 2009. His interest in writing started at the age of thirteen. He has condensed his vast experience of life and dealing with public in this book From Stagnation to Vibrant Living for the benefit of his readers.
